This article in the journal "Gruppe. Interaktion. Organisation. (GIO)" provides an overview of the manifold digitization and automation possibilities that current technological developments provide for training and development and discusses the opportunities and risks of their use.To remain competitive, efficient, and productive, organizations need to ensure that their employees continue to learn and develop. However, training all employees in all necessary competencies requires a lot of resources. To be able to use these resources optimally, the developmental needs of the employees must be determined continuously and accurately so that these can be addressed in a targeted and adequate manner through suitable training and development activities. These administrative processes of training and development are also resource-intensive. For this reason, organizations made use of a variety of technologies in the past to make training and development and the associated administrative processes more efficient and manageable through digitization (e.g., by providing digital learning materials). In this article, we highlight the diverse digitization and automation possibilities that current technological developments offer and illustrate them-structured along the process of personnel development-with examples from research and practice.
